Program Director (Electromagnetic Spectrum Management Unit)
https://beta.nsf.gov/careers/openings/mps/ast/ast-2022-85588 Position SummaryThe National Science Foundation (NSF) is seeking qualified candidates for the position of Program Director within the Electromagnetic Spectrum Management Unit (ESMU), Division of Astronomical Sciences (AST), Directorate for Mathematical and Physical Sciences (MPS), Alexandria, VA. The objective of NSF’s ESMU is to ensure access by the scientific community to portions of the radio spectrum that are needed for research purposes, especially for radio astronomy.
